你查询的IP:[116.4.201.125]  地理位置:中国–广东–东莞

最新查询122.4.32.97 117.60.123.28 60.200.173.87 168.160.254.148 119.88.151.82 210.2.197.253 121.204.98.72 119.2.120.235 123.137.159.1 116.4.201.125 202.160.176.11 202.38.149.90 119.18.224.166 122.96.239.202 61.48.207.254 218.249.24.255 119.108.8.79 202.125.176.148 203.142.219.69 203.118.192.56 122.240.171.132 120.90.113.226 220.112.127.81 119.60.65.105 116.112.157.115 221.133.224.201 203.100.32.184 125.61.128.68 117.128.215.148 125.31.192.60 202.127.128.85